“Artificial intelligence supports collective design in architecture”
At the “Artificial Intelligence in Design” event organized by Istanbul Medipol University’s Department of Interior Architecture and Environmental Design, Synthetic Architecture Co-Founders Pınar Ongun and Ozan Ertuğ discussed the transformation that artificial intelligence is bringing to the discipline of architecture.

The Department of Interior Architecture and Environmental Design of the School of Fine Arts, Design, and Architecture at Istanbul Medipol University organized an event titled “Artificial Intelligence in Design”. Synthetic Architecture founding partners Pınar Ongun and Ozan Ertuğ met with students at the event, which was held at the South Campus. Ongun and Ertuğ touched on the transformation that artificial intelligence technology has created in the discipline of architecture and its effects on design processes. They stated that artificial intelligence-supported design processes provide a collective creation area and are used as a tool to strengthen storytelling in architecture.
ONGUN: ARTIFICIAL INTELLIGENCE SUPPORTS COLLECTIVE DESIGN IN ARCHITECTURE
Speaking at the event, Pınar Ongun stated that the integration of artificial intelligence with architecture has added a new dimension to design processes. Ongun said: “Synthetic approaches in architecture open up a new creative field by combining traditional methods with artificial intelligence-based design.” Ongun emphasized that techniques such as drawing, physical modeling, and parametric designing have become more comprehensive thanks to artificial intelligence. According to Ongun, this integration not only accelerates design processes, but also provides a more diverse, flexible, and dynamic production environment. She continued as follows: “Artificial intelligence creates a new architectural understanding by balancing global knowledge with local needs. Although the concept of ‘artificial’ is sometimes misunderstood, the process is not just about the results produced by algorithms; it is a creative process shaped by patterns gathered from large pools of data. We take geographical, climatic, and cultural factors into consideration in our designs. Artificial intelligence contributes to a polyphonic, innovative, and sustainable design understanding by revealing the power of collective knowledge in architecture.”
